3. Download RithmicBridgeFilesForSierraChart.zip and extract to the RIM folder e.g. C:\SierraChart\Rim
4. Login to SierraChart, go to Global Settings -> Data/Trade settings and enter your Rithmic username / credentials. These are the ones sent to you by Earn2Trade. Select 'Rithmic Paper Trading' from the options.
5. Click on File -> Connect to data feed
6. Make sure the gauntlet account shows up in Trade -> Account Balances window
7. Use correct symbol e.g. for ES use ESU0-CME intraday chart.
DONT's:
1. Do not use Simulation Mode (Trade -> Trade simulation mode off)
2. Do not start the executable in Rim folder as a standalone, SierraChart will start it automatically
